PACIFIC DISEASES.
BIG TRAINING SCHEME. In collaboration with tlie Rockefeller Foundation, the Government and the High Commission of the Western Pacific are about to put into effect a big scheme for students from all the groups in the Western Pacific to be trained in tropical medicine at Suva. Special buildings are to he erected. The foundation will finance the movement to the extent of £15,000 or more. The idea is founded upon the partial but valuable training now given to what is known as native medical practitioners, who are distributed among the outer islands, and -who have been doing excellent work for years among the native population.
